Origins and Background of the China Study PDF



Historical Context


The China Study was a collaborative project between Cornell University, Oxford University, and the Chinese Academy of Preventive Medicine. Conducted over 20 years, the study collected data from over 100 Chinese counties, involving more than 6,500 adults. It aimed to explore how dietary patterns influence the incidence of major diseases.

Key Findings and Implications from the China Study PDF



The study's findings have significant implications for public health, nutrition science, and individual dietary choices.

Major Conclusions



  • Consumption of whole, plant-based foods is associated with lower incidence of chronic diseases.

  • High intake of animal protein and processed foods correlates with increased disease risk.

  • Dietary patterns can influence gene expression and disease development.

  • Transitioning to a whole-food, plant-based diet can improve health outcomes and reduce healthcare costs.



Impact on Dietary Guidelines


The findings challenge traditional Western dietary guidelines that often emphasize animal products and processed foods. They support a shift toward plant-based nutrition as a preventative health measure.

Criticisms and Limitations of the China Study PDF



While the China Study provides compelling evidence, it is essential to consider criticisms:


  • Some critics argue that correlation does not imply causation; other lifestyle factors may influence health outcomes.

  • The study's focus on rural Chinese populations may limit direct applicability to Western diets.

  • Further research is needed to confirm long-term effects and establish definitive dietary guidelines.



Despite these limitations, the core messages about plant-based diets and disease prevention remain influential.
